Rubber can be classified as a renewable resource when it comes from natural sources, such as rubber trees (Hevea brasiliensis), which can be tapped for latex without cutting down the tree. However, synthetic rubber, made from petroleum products, is nonrenewable. The sustainability of natural rubber production depends on responsible harvesting and land management practices.
